Avalon - Hey Hey Hey ! You will get to the beach - just relax. It was impossible to save the turtle crossing Avalon Blvd. Drivers thought it was the Indy 500 even with two of us on the shoulder signaling to slow down. The two cars completely squished the turtle. Can’t we all just get along ? Can turtles live too ??

